Ingredients
For the Crab Cake Egg Rolls:
- 8 egg roll wrappers
- 1 lb (450g) lump crab meat, drained and patted dry
- ½ cup (120g) mayonnaise
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
- 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on Old Bay seasoning
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on onion pow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
- 1 egg, lightly beaten
- ¼ cup (30g) breadcrumbs
- 1 green onion, finely chopped
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
- Vegetable oil, for frying
For the Lemon Dipping Sauce:
- ½ cup (120g) mayonnaise
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est
- 1 teaspoon honey
- ½ teaspoon Old Bay seasoning
- 1 clove garlic, minced
How to Make Crispy Crab Cake Egg Rolls with Lemon Dip
Step 1: Prepare the Crab Cake Filling
- In a large bowl, combine crab meat,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, Worcestershire sauce, Old Bay seasoning,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per.
- Stir in the egg, breadcrumbs, green onion, parsley, and lemon juice until well combined.
- Let the mixture sit for 10 minutes to allow flavors to meld.
Step 2: Assemble the Egg Rolls
- Lay an egg roll wrapper on a clean surface, with a corner facing you like a diamond.
- Spoon 2-3 tablespoons of the crab mixture into the center.
- Fold the bottom corner over the filling, then fold in the sides and roll tightly, sealing the edge with a dab of water.
- Repeat with the remaining wrappers and filling.
Step 3: Fry the Egg Rolls
- Heat 2 inches of vegetable oil in a deep pan to 350°F (175°C).
- Fry the egg rolls in batches for 3-4 minutes per side, or until golden brown and crispy.
- Remove and drain on a paper towel-lined plate.
Step 4: Make the Lemon Dipping Sauce
- In a small b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, lemon zest, honey, Old Bay seasoning, and minced garlic.
- Chill for at least 10 minutes before serving.
Step 5: Serve and Enjoy!
- Arrange the crispy crab cake egg rolls on a platter.
- Serve with the lemon dipping sauce on the side.
- Garnish with extra parsley and lemon wedges for a fresh touch.
Tips for the Best Crab Cake Egg Rolls
✔ Use Fresh Crab Meat – For the best flavor, opt for lump crab meat instead of imitation.
✔ Don’t Overfill the Wrappers – This prevents them from bursting while frying.
✔ Seal the Edges Well – Use a little water to make sure the rolls stay closed.
✔ Fry in Small Batches – Overcrowding the pan can lead to soggy egg rolls.
✔ Serve Immediately – These are best when crispy and fresh!

How to Store & Reheat
Storage:
- Keep le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days.
Reheating:
- Air Fryer: Heat at 350°F (175°C) for 5 minutes.
- Oven: Bake at 375°F (190°C) for 10 minutes.
- Avoid microwaving – It makes them soggy!
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Bake the Egg Rolls Instead of Frying?
Yes! Brush with oil and bake at 400°F (200°C) for 12-15 minutes, flipping halfway.
Can I Use Canned Crab Meat?
Yes, but fresh or refrigerated lump crab has the best taste and texture.
Can I Make These Ahead of Time?
Yes! Assemble the egg rolls and freeze them uncooked. Fry straight from frozen, adding an extra minute.
